Anminer s3 bricked after firmware upgrade..... a firmware upgrade was performed on my s3 and now it seems to be bricked. no way to login to it in current state. not really sure what protocol seems to be at this point i have contacted Bitmain several times (on bitcointalk, the bitmain site, and via RMA email) about this issue with no response. aside from using it as a paperweight, anyone have suggestions on how to fix or get it going once again...is this s3 bricked state even fixable ? thanks in advance for all input and help. Hi, I have the same problem before a Firmware upgrade, so, i decide open the BOX. The Antminer S3 use a AR9331 Module, this module is like a any other router that is compatible with OpenWRT. ( http://www.aliexpress.com/item/AR9331-module-support-openwrt-platform-support-the-Internet-of-things-applications/2000720631.html) Loking the board and the pinout of AR931 i descover this: https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/2113596/0-Miner.pngWith that proceeded to identify which was the TX and RX serial port in the plane is said to TX and RX pin 16 Pin 17 With that proceeded to identify which was the TX and RX serial port in the plane is said to TX and RX pin 16 Pin 17 I had to soldering on the pin board on March 1 order then would wire the port and not soldered to the board directly. Use yellow for RX, TX to Red and Black to GND, as shown in the following image: https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/2113596/IMG_20140831_212859829.jpgNow connect the serial port to use an Arduino one that can become a Serial to USB converter only by bridging from RESET to GND and the Arduino board are clearly where the RX, TX, GND to the serial port. https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/2113596/IMG_20140831_212848867.jpgThen it was just a matter of connecting it to the computer and see what happens in a finish as Minicom or Hyperterminal, I use linux for all these things then for me it was easy, just had to run the command: screen /dev/ttyACM0 115200 Where /dev/ttyACM0 is the serial port that is created to connect the arduino board to pc. https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/2113596/HackingMinero.pngWhen connecting either achieved was only a matter of time to achieve putting on good firmware to do this is as follows: 1 It is necessary that your computer has the IP 192.168.1.100 2. install and configure a tftp server on which team has the firware, I use the version: antMiner_S320140811.bin After having the TFTP server on your computer and have the computer connected by serial Mining and the lan port only has to ejectuar the following commands: tftp 0x81000000 antMiner_S320140811.bin cp.b 0x81000000 0x7c0000 0x9f020000 bootm 0x9f020000 Longer then promise you to to make a better guide.
